Unlike laptops and tablets, the TI-84 Plus CE Python graphing calculator does not have any distractions like Wi-Fi, Bluetooth or a camera, keeping kids focused on learning. The new TI-84 Plus CE Python graphing calculator includes familiar features like a full-color screen, lightweight design and a rechargeable battery that can last up to a month on a single charge. TI calculators generally fall into two distinct groups, those powered by Zilog Z80 and those powered by the Motorola 68000 CPU.

According to the official site, a few years later, they came up with a major design upgrade with the TI-NSPIRE, which allowed students to display multiple representations on a single screen, explore cause and effect and save work. In 2001, the TI-83 was released so students could graph and compare functions and perform data plotting and analysis. In 1998, Texas Instruments integrated flash technology into their calculators, specifically the TI-73 and TI-89 devices. This could be used for Algebra and Precalculus. In 1990 their first graphing calculator was released, the TI-81. According to the official site, the TI SR-50 had many functions including trigonometric, hyperbolic and logarithms and their inverses. Their first scientific calculator, the TI SR-50, followed shortly after that in 1974. The first calculator released for the retail market was the TI-2500 Datamath in 1972. In 1967, they invented the first electronic handheld calculator, the Cal-Tech, which performed basic math functions. Texas Instruments is a global technology company based in Dallas, TX that designs and manufactures numerous electronics.
